While Priesthill & Darnley may not offer the grandeur of larger terminals, it ensures that necessary services are within your reach. Ticket machines are ready to assist you, allowing you to collect pre-purchased tickets seamlessly. Though there is no manned ticket office, the presence of smartcard validators keeps it modern and efficient. Accessibility-wise, the station provides partial step-free access, accommodating those with mobility needs on one side of the station, although it's noted that embarking on certain platforms could require extra care due to stepping distances.
In terms of assistance, travelers will find help points to address basic inquiries and receive updates via departure screens and announcements. Those in need of more extensive support might find assistance lacking, as staff help isn't consistently available. For any issues or lost items, assistance is reachable through customer service contacts, and CCTV ensures an added element of security.

While modest in size, Theobalds Grove station is equipped with essential amenities designed to help you navigate your journey with ease. Although it lacks an on-site ticket office, automated ticket machines are provided for you to purchase or collect pre-booked tickets effortlessly. The station supports accessible ticketing facilities, offering an induction loop for those with hearing impairments.
For individuals requiring assistance, the station staff is available from the early hours of the morning to late at night. Passenger information can be accessed through departure and arrival screens and regular announcements, ensuring that you stay informed about your train's status or any service updates.
Theobalds Grove prioritizes accessibility, albeit offering limited step-free access. The station lacks fully accessible platforms, but it does feature three parking spaces specifically for accessible vehicles. There’s no waiting room or toilets, yet passengers can find refuge in the available seating areas. Additionally, vending machines offer refreshments to keep travelers refreshed during their journey.
